I'm switching my 69 B body with power steering and auto trans to manual. Will an A body box/column work on a B body? From what I can gather they should...I found a complete set up and just want to be certain before I buy.

the column won't fit cuz the outer housing is also too short and the mounting brackets are at different positions.

Two different pitman shaft diameters. Make sure that the correct pitman arm is available to fit .

Thanks for the input. I'm rebuilding the front end so the pitman arm should not be an issue. According to some others the mounting may not be a a problem as the mounting holes are the same on both columns, it the hardware that is different, which I should be able to re-purpose from my auto column. I'm sure the missing piece of the puzzle will be the length. I'm going to proceed as planned. I priced out the parts to convert mine with the collar kit from Tony's...$125, manual adapter from Mancini...$185 and the steering wheel, with the horn ring and pad I need is around...name you're price. I also have and early B body auto,column that might come in handy too....I would still appreciate some additional comments good or bad on the subject though.
